Mission Statement

We are a community-based, character-building, youth development organization. We deliver the highest quality programs and provide opportunities to assist youth and teens in developing their self-esteem, values, and skills in a safe and fun environment. Our professionals guide members through personal, educational, and social development to realize their full potential and become positive, value-oriented, and productive citizens.

Description

Many children have no adult supervision after school. Studies have shown that the hours between 3 and 7 p.m. are the hours that most kids are likely to get involved with crimes, be victims of crime or engage in other risky behavior. The Clubs provide an alternative to the dangers of the streets. Moreover, the Clubs provide stimulating activities that help build character, self-esteem, values, and skills.
